This was my first Picoult book and I have to say I loved it. **SPOILER ALERT** Initially having to switch back and forth between narrators and fonts stumped me, but once I got into the book, I realized it helped keep my attention. It would have me wondering what this person's point of view was going to be. I have to agree with a lot of the reviewers on Sara's selfishness and obvious favoritism towards Kate. This book is like the grown up big sister to all those "Don't Die My Love" and "A Summer for Dying" and "Dying For A Prom" books by Lurlene McDaniels that my friends and I devoured when we were 12.
